Nutritional Profile:
Broccoli, scientifically known as Brassica oleracea, belongs to the family Brassicaceae. This vegetable is rich in an array of essential nutrients, making it a vital component of a healthy diet. When it comes to calcium content, broccoli reigns supreme. A 100-gram serving of broccoli offers approximately 47 milligrams of calcium, accounting for around 4.7% of the recommended daily intake for adults. While this may not seem significant, it becomes noteworthy when considering the numerous health benefits associated with calcium-rich foods.
Health Benefits:
1. Bone Health: Calcium is crucial for maintaining strong and healthy bones. It plays a vital role in bone formation, density, and overall skeletal strength. Regular consumption of calcium-rich foods like broccoli can contribute to preventing conditions such as osteoporosis and fractures, particularly in older adults.
2. Dental Health: Calcium is not only essential for bone health but also for maintaining strong teeth. Adequate calcium intake helps prevent tooth decay and strengthens tooth enamel, reducing the risk of dental problems such as cavities and gum disease.
3. Blood Pressure Regulation: Broccoli’s calcium content can potentially aid in regulating blood pressure. Calcium helps to maintain proper muscle function, including the muscles responsible for blood vessel constriction and relaxation. By promoting healthy blood pressure levels, calcium-rich foods like broccoli may reduce the risk of hypertension and associated cardiovascular complications.
4. Colon Health: The high fiber content in broccoli, combined with its calcium content, contributes to a healthy digestive system. Calcium has been linked to a reduced risk of colon cancer, as it binds to bile acids in the colon, preventing their conversion into cancer-causing compounds.
5. Weight Management: Broccoli’s calcium content has also been associated with weight management. Studies have shown that an adequate intake of calcium may aid in maintaining a healthy body weight and reducing the risk of obesity. Calcium-rich foods can promote a sense of fullness and satiety, potentially curbing overeating and aiding in weight loss efforts.
Culinary Uses:
Apart from its nutritional benefits, broccoli can be a delicious and versatile addition to various culinary creations. Here are some popular ways to incorporate calcium-rich broccoli into your diet:
1. Steamed: Steaming broccoli helps retain its nutrients while maintaining a vibrant green color. Serve it as a side dish with a sprinkle of lemon juice or a drizzle of olive oil.
2. Stir-Fry: Add broccoli florets to your favorite stir-fry recipe for a quick and nutritious meal. Combine it with other vegetables, lean protein, and a flavorful sauce for a well-balanced dish.
3. Roasted: Roasting broccoli enhances its natural flavors and yields a slightly caramelized texture. Toss florets with a touch of olive oil, salt, and pepper, then roast in the oven until tender and golden brown.
4. Soups and Stews: Blend steamed broccoli into soups or stews for added creaminess and nutritional value. Combine it with other vegetables, herbs, and spices to create a comforting and nutritious meal.
5. Salads: Raw broccoli can add a delightful crunch and freshness to salads. Combine it with other colorful vegetables, fruits, nuts, and a tangy dressing for a refreshing and nutrient-packed salad.
